ABSTRACT

As a kind of finance innovation for direct lending between individuals, P2P develops rapidly in recent ten years. However, while it is promoting China’s economic development, various problems related to P2P network credit and loan are appearing gradually. If P2P wants to develop continuously, the core is to strengthen the risk management. Based on the analysis of the concept, model and positive significance of P2P network credit and loan, this paper mainly expounds the credit risks, information risks, operational risk, regulatory and legal risks and liquidity risk that P2P network credit and loan faces, and comes up with the solutions to these problems, for example, setting up the credit system, perfecting internal control as well as strengthening supervision and industrial self-regulation, combining big data technology. These present some new ideas of performing risks management for P2P.
